riddlet-bot
The official bot library for Riddlet, the anonymous chat application and server.
Installation
Installation is fairly simple. Just run npm install --save riddlet-bot
in your project directory.
Your first bot
The official bot library allows for very barebones bot creation.
Simple Log Bot
To create a bot, you first want to create a new RiddletBot
class.
var RiddletBot = require('riddlet-bot').RiddletBot
var bot = new RiddletBot("http://chat.example.com")
You should know if if this works when you get a token printed to your terminal. (ie: xxxxxxxxxxxxx.yyyyyyyyyyyy.zzzzzzzzzzzz
)
We now want to stop the bot process and put that token as a second parameter. This allows our bot to have the same token each time it connects to the server.
var bot = new RiddletBot("http://chat.example.com", "xxxxxxxxxxxxx.yyyyyyyyyyyy.zzzzzzzzzzzz")
Your bot should now log every message it recieves from the server.
Custom Message Handler
Now to create a custom Message Handler.
Here is an example message handler that we will be using.
var xMessageHandler = function (bot, message) {
if(message.data === "!info") {
bot.SendMessage("test", "#all")
}
}
Now we want to import it into our bot.
var bot = new RiddletBot("http://chat.example.com", "xxxxxxxxxxxxx.yyyyyyyyyyyy.zzzzzzzzzzzz", xMessageHandler)
And that's your first bot!
